FORT WAYNE, Ind. (WOWO): A 17-year-old Fort Wayne teen was killed in a crash on Tuesday.
The Allen County Coroner’s Office said Peytin India Chamble died from blunt force trauma due to a motor vehicle crash. The manner of death was ruled an accident.
At about 1:30 p.m. Tuesday, Nov. 22, crews were called to East Washington Boulevard near White Avenue on reports of a crash. Police found a car resting on its top in a parking lot when they arrived.
Police believe the car was going east on Washington when it lost control, jumped a curb and flipped multiple times.
She is the 34th traffic fatality in Fort Wayne this year.
The crash is under investigation the Fort Wayne Police Department F.A.C.T.
